Actions
Anomalie #2137
fermé[Script] Lors de l'éxécution d'une commande en CLI le exit error retourné devrait être en cohérence avec le résultat de l'opération
Statut:
Rejeté
Priorité:
Normal
Assigné à:
-
Version cible:
-
Début:
19/10/2011
Echéance:
% réalisé:
0%
Temps estimé:
Version source:
Solution proposée:
Créer une librairie de gestion des retour comme celle de usage
Principaux fichiers impactés:
Complexité:
Contrôle:
Thème:
Régression:
Description
Lors de l'exécution d'une commande en CLI le status code retourné devrait être en cohérence avec le compte rendu de l’exécution du script. Ce status code est utilisé dans le wiff et autre pour agir en conséquence (gestion d'exception)
Actions
#1
Mis à jour par Éric Brison il y a plus de 14 ans
- Statut changé de Nouveau à Rejeté
L'appel à $action->exitError() provoque déjà une exception lors de l'utilisation de wsh.
~$ ./wsh.php --app=FDL --action=FDL_CARD --id=3783269; echo $?
26/10/2011 14:06:14 LOG::[I] Dynacase:FDL:FDL_CARD Default Master [1] - : FDL:FDL_CARD []
Erreur : impossible de voir : la référence 3783269 est inconnue
1
C'est de la responsabilité du script d'appeler le exitError en cas d'échec.
Actions